 John BERGER (Southern Metropolitan) (17:33): (2495) My adjournment matter is for the Minister for Roads and Road Safety. Local roads are used every day by families, workers, students, tradies, public transport users and freight operators across Southern Metro. Whether people are driving to work, catching a bus, heading to school drop-off or travelling to local businesses, well-maintained roads matter. That is why the Labor government’s road blitz is so important. It is about getting on with the practical work of repairing, resurfacing and maintaining roads across Victoria, making journeys safer and smoother for local communities. This work also supports many local workers who rely on our road network every day, including emergency services, bus drivers, delivery workers and small businesses. I commend the minister for the government’s continued focus on road maintenance and road safety, and the action I seek is for the minister to provide my office with information on how the road maintenance blitz will benefit the community of Southern Metro.
